Recursion !

What is recursion?

Recursion is called a process by which a function calls itself repeatedly, until a certain condition is satisfied, if there is no specific case that terminates the recursion, an infinite loop could be created.


Calculate the power of a number using recursion:

Now let’s see how this would look step by step using stack and LIFO method:

Final result = 25

I hope you enjoyed reading this blog and learned what you need to know about recursion

A dream doesn’t magically come true, it takes sweat, determination and hard work — Colin Powell




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

9 Super Useful Tricks for JavaScript Developers

You should know this topics for becoming a JavaScript Developer.


Node JS Server with Express framework

Build an Ethereum DApp Using Ethers.js

ionBooking 2 — Ionic 5 Hotel Booking Theme

Setup a Micro Frontend Architecture With Vue and single-spa

Person stacking colorful blocks on top of each other.

Performance Testing with JMeter

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store
Smith Flores

Smith Flores

More from Medium

Cue the Vitamin C — Graduation (Friends Forever) Song!

Laptop wearing a graduation hat

C++ Program to find all prime numbers from 0 up to a given number N

Add Two Linked List Numbers

Version control learning